Pin 807 / wire number 24 on the A5 card is the ignition start wire, stick +48 volts on to this & see if the truck starts up.

There is +48 volts on pin 805 / wire number 21 from fuse F60 you can use.

F60 should be the top 10 amp fuse in that fuse holder inside the motor compartment.

I take it you have stuck your hand up the dash & checked the keypad is still plugged in, I have had one come undone before where people like to have a fiddle.
